  • RFIE issued on L1B Extension

    Hi All,

    I have received RFIE today on my L1B extension. Pls let me know the difference between RFE and RFIE. On what basis, they will raise RFIE.

    I have to respond to RFIE at the earliest as my 240 days is getting over in 2 months. Pls share me your feedback about RFIE process.

    Thanks for your help in advance!


  • #2
    hi Both are one at the Sam, pls Check the RFIE - if its L1 B, it will be more on the specialized Knowledge and Tools used. Try yo respond at the earliest, looks like u have only 2 months before ur 240 days ,once the Response is received, usually USCIS responds in 30-45 days for RFE's. So u can try your Luck by submitting the response.

    Also, is this only L1 Extension ? or Amendment + Extension ? if Amendment + Extension then 240 day rule doesn't apply i guess ,
